This September, I'm taking on the Great Cycle Challenge and committing to ride 400 miles to help fight childhood cancer.
Why? Because cancer is still the leading cause of death by disease among children in the United States. Every year, more than 15,700 children are diagnosed with cancer, and 38 children lose their lives every week.
